My buddy broke the screen on his 57" Toshiba projection. With a wii controller (big surprise). The TV still works fine the front screen is just broken. Anybody know the approx. replacement cost?

If its just the clear scratch guard thats broken, and it isnt laminated to the projection surface you should be able to use a big sheet of lexan to replace it. only drawback is it wont have the coatings on it so some light sources will be a  :censored: for some viewing angles.
